74 percent of applicants to Louisiana State University and Agricultural & Mechanical College were admitted for fall 2018

At Louisiana State University and Agricultural & Mechanical College, 95 percent of undergraduate students are traditional students - age 24 or younger - and 53 percent are female, according to the latest disclosure from the U.S. Department of Education.

The four-year public institution in Baton Rouge enrolled 30,983 students in fall 2018, including 25,233 in undergraduate and 5,750 in graduate programs, data shows. 2.9 percent of undergraduates transferred from another college or university.

77 percent of undergraduates are residents of Louisiana, and 22 percent are residents of other states. 1 percent are citizens of foreign countries.

The undergraduate student body is comprised mostly of students who identify as white (70 percent) and Black or African American (13 percent).

The school admitted 74 percent of the 24,280 students who applied for fall 2018. Of those who were admitted, 32 percent enrolled.
